About

E. Aughey is a scholar working on Health, Toxicology and Mutagenesis, Nutrition and Dietetics and Agronomy and Crop Science. According to data from OpenAlex, E. Aughey has authored 30 papers receiving a total of 551 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Health, Toxicology and Mutagenesis, 7 papers in Nutrition and Dietetics and 7 papers in Agronomy and Crop Science. Recurrent topics in E. Aughey’s work include Heavy Metal Exposure and Toxicity (7 papers), Trace Elements in Health (7 papers) and Reproductive Physiology in Livestock (7 papers). E. Aughey is often cited by papers focused on Heavy Metal Exposure and Toxicity (7 papers), Trace Elements in Health (7 papers) and Reproductive Physiology in Livestock (7 papers). E. Aughey collaborates with scholars based in United Kingdom, Canada and Australia. E. Aughey's co-authors include R. Scott, G. S. Fell, Marjorie Black, Gordon S. Fell, Valerie A. Ferro, Mary Waterston, Angela Colston, Brian L. Furman, Ravi Gooneratne and Md. Abu Hadi Noor Ali Khan and has published in prestigious journals such as Environmental Health Perspectives, Vaccine and Reproduction.
